Important differences between leberkäse and pacific saury raw

  • Leberkäse has more vitamin B12, vitamin A, vitamin B2, iron, vitamin B3, vitamin B5, and selenium than pacific saury raw.
  • Leberkäse's daily need coverage for vitamin B12 is 940% more.
  • Leberkäse contains 250 times more vitamin A than pacific saury raw. Leberkäse contains 17490IU of vitamin A, while pacific saury raw contains 70IU.
  • Pacific saury raw contains less saturated fat.
  • Leberkäse has a higher glycemic index. The glycemic index of leberkäse is 28, while the glycemic index of pacific saury raw is 0.
